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ute a comprehensive tax strategy that supports the company’s business goals and long-term financial health
  • Serve as the primary tax advisor to the Head of Accounting
  • Provide insights on the tax implications of strategic initiatives, including expansion, new product launches, and acquisitions
  • Stay current with evolving tax laws and regulations, advising on their potential impact to the company
  • Oversee all U.S. federal, state, and international tax filings, ensuring timely and accurate compliance
  • Manage annual tax provision process (ASC 740), including review of tax accruals, deferred tax calculations, and financial statement disclosures
  • Manage Indirect taxes, including US sales tax and international GST and VAT reporting including accurate and timely filings while maintaining appropriate audit support
  • Maintain robust internal controls and documentation to support tax positions and audits
  • Partner with the accounting team to ensure seamless integration between tax reporting and financial close processes
  • Identify and implement opportunities for tax efficiencies, including structural optimization, credits and incentives, and international tax strategies
  • Support transfer pricing, intercompany transactions, and cross-border operations
  • Lead tax due diligence and integration efforts related to M&A activity

About Vanta

Vanta simplifies the process of obtaining and maintaining SOC 2 certification, which is essential for organizations that manage sensitive customer data. The company offers a software-as-a-service (SaaS) platform that automates numerous checks to ensure that security controls are effective and compliant with industry standards. This automation helps small to med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) and tech companies monitor risks and vulnerabilities continuously, significantly reducing the time and cost associated with achieving SOC 2 compliance. Vanta's subscription-based model provides clients with a more efficient and cost-effective way to maintain compliance compared to traditional methods. The goal of Vanta is to transform the compliance process, allowing organizations to focus on their core operations while enhancing their security posture.
